All Categories
Featured
Table of Contents
By the end of this area, you will certainly have a strong understanding of the technological facets you need to focus on to excel in Opn's design meeting. Carrying on to Part 2 of our blog collection, we will shift our attention to behavior concerns and what to anticipate throughout the interview process.
We also use Google Jamboard for the layout round. Our interview process at Opn is uncomplicated, and we guarantee you are well-prepared for the technological rounds.
The technical interview contains 2 rounds: (a) the coding round and (b) the design round, each lasting one hour. You will certainly have 50 minutes to react to inquiries and 10 mins for Q&A. Depending on the availability of both the prospect and the recruiter, these rounds might occur on various days.
Probably, it has been a very long time since you last touched them, so take enough time to go back to exercise. Comprehend the ideas, study the syntax really meticulously, and get aware of different methods of reacting to the concerns. During the meeting, prior to trying to create your service, you may intend to very first clarify the question with the recruiter, examine the problem, and information the reasoning and why you will pick this approach to solving the trouble.
It is very important to mention that the recruiters desire you to do well and are there to sustain you. Rationale for you is to reveal the job interviewer just how you assume, connect, and whether you can address troubles. By doing so, you have actually opened the floor to involve much more with the interviewer and invite any type of suggestions associated with dealing with the coding troubles.
Still, it prevails amongst our job interviewers to ask concerns around the subject of repayment gateways as this will be most pertinent to your daily work. In the style round, prospects are encouraged to provide their perfect software architecture style to implement a hypothetical solution under certain restrictions. Inquiries can include: Style a repayment system for a shopping system.
Layout an e-commerce vendor acquisition and client platform system. Layout a system that enables each individual to send out messages or pictures. When being spoken with and during coding rounds, it's handy to repeat the inquiries to the recruiter to make certain that both of you get on the very same page. If you don't understand, do not hesitate to ask the job interviewer to repeat or put in other words the question.
I have actually been a full desk technical recruiter for virtually 10 years. Most of my time has been spent as a company employer with Code Talent, but I likewise have a year of inner recruiting experience on Twitter's Income Platform team.
I would love to flag that the guidance provided is based upon my personal point of views and experience, and ought to not be taken into consideration an endorsement of the employing processes used in large technology, or by business mimicing big tech hiring. Rather, it is meant to give support on how to navigate the "market standard" interview process and improve your opportunities of success.
In all seriousness, you can tell a whole lot regarding your positioning to a business and their values based on this page. Furthermore, websites like Glassdoor and Blind can give beneficial understandings right into the business's meeting process, worker experiences, and wages. It's likewise a great idea to investigate your recruiter and their role to obtain a far better understanding of their perspective and what they may be looking for in a candidate.
How has the meeting process been so far? Frequently our impulses are powerful devices that are ignored; it's essential to address any kind of appointments concerning the function or company prior to continuing with the process.
Treat every practice as a meeting; it might even assist with those video game day nerves! In the 'Expertise is Power' section, I pointed out the value of recognizing business values.
In addition, the STAR approach will certainly assist you produce response to potential behavior meeting concerns. Develop STAR instances for each and every bullet in the work summary (if there are way too many bullets, gather styles). Behavior interview concerns are typically taken straight from these job description bullet factors. : Solid analytical skills, with the capability to think creatively and strategically to fix complex technological challenges -> Tell me regarding a time you experienced barriers and challenges at job.
By demonstrating excellent partnership skills, discussing their assumed procedures, and most significantly, their errors. During the technological interview, maintain these inquiries in mind: Have you collected your needs? Are you checking in with your job interviewer?
Ask for a minute. It's okay to take a break. Being sincere and susceptible (when secure) can aid you stand out from other candidates.
Keep in mind, you're freaking remarkable, and your distinct qualities and experiences can help you land your dream task so long as it's the right fit for you.'s a checklist of business that do not white boards or adhere to "typical tech" interview procedures, phew.
Do look into all these inquiries with responses from listed below: Software Application Engineering Interview Questions is the procedure of making, creating, screening, and preserving software program. It is a systematic and self-displined approach to software application advancement that aims to develop high-quality, trustworthy, and maintainable software program. Software application engineers produce software application remedies for end customers by using design concepts and their understanding of programming languages.
It is a features of software that refers to its ability to execute what it was created to do precisely and consistently gradually. It refers to the level to which the software application can be used easily. The quantity of initiative or time called for to find out how to use the software program.
It describes just how easy it is to enhance and change the software program. It refers to exactly how conveniently a software application system can be modified to add feature, enhance speed, or repair mistakes. It describes exactly how well the software program can work on different platforms or situations without making major adjustments.
For more details please refer to the adhering to article Features of Software program. The software program is utilized thoroughly in numerous domains including hospitals, financial institutions, colleges, defense, money, securities market, and so forth. It can be categorized right into various kinds: For more details please refer to the adhering to short article Classifications of Software program.
It is defined by a structured, consecutive technique to task management and software development. Requirements Collecting and AnalysisDesign PhaseImplementation and Unit T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and repaired that may not change. There are no ambiguous demands (no confusion). It is excellent to utilize this version when the modern technology is well recognized.
Beta testing typically uses black-box screening. Alpha testing is done by testers who are usually inner employees of the company. Beta screening is executed by clients who are not part of the company. Alpha screening is executed at the developer's site. Beta testing is performed at the end-user, the of the product.
Dependability, safety and security, and robustness are checked throughout beta screening. Alpha testing guarantees the high quality of the item before forwarding it to beta testing. Beta testing also focuses on the high quality of the item however collects the customer's time-long input on the product and guarantees that the product is all set for real-time customers.
Table of Contents
Latest Posts
3 Simple Techniques For Top Machine Learning Courses & Certifications [Free Guide]
Facebook Software Engineer Interview Guide – What You Need To Know
How To Prepare For A Software Engineering Whiteboard Interview
More
Latest Posts
3 Simple Techniques For Top Machine Learning Courses & Certifications [Free Guide]
Facebook Software Engineer Interview Guide – What You Need To Know
How To Prepare For A Software Engineering Whiteboard Interview